18

私は非常にトラフィックの多いソーシャル ネットワーク サイトを持ってい
ます。大きな配列と mysql オブジェクト、さらにはいくつかの文字列変数の設定を解除する習慣を身に付けたいと考えています。

PHPで複数のアイテムの設定を解除することは可能ですか

例:

<?PHP

unset($var1);

// could be like

unset($var1,$var2,$var3);

?>
4

4 に答える 4

38

はい。

あなたの例は、あなたが想像しているように機能します。のメソッド シグネチャunset()は次のとおりです。

void unset ( mixed $var [, mixed $var [, mixed $... ]] )
于 2009-08-14T02:36:22.407 に答える
13

PHP マニュアルは非常に便利です。任意の組み込み関数を検索して、その関数が何をするかなどのかなり詳細な説明を取得できます。答えはイエスunsetです。必要な数の変数を指定できます。

于 2009-08-14T02:40:24.307 に答える
3

はい。PHP マニュアルの例 1 を参照してください。

http://us2.php.net/manual/en/function.unset.php

于 2009-08-14T02:38:42.420 に答える
0

また、任意の PHP 関数を拡張することもできます。例を見てください。

function multiply_foo()
{
    foreach(func_get_args() AS $arg)
        foo($arg);
}

multiply_foo($arg1, $arg2, $arg3);

PHP経由 : func_get_args

于 2012-06-26T20:56:01.510 に答える